gnutls_x509_crq_export (3) Linux Manual Page
gnutls_x509_crq_export – API function
Synopsis
#include <gnutls/x509.h> int gnutls_x509_crq_export(gnutls_x509_crq_t crq, gnutls_x509_crt_fmt_t format, void * output_data, size_t * output_data_size);
Arguments
- gnutls_x509_crq_t crq
- should contain a gnutls_x509_crq_t structure
- gnutls_x509_crt_fmt_t format
- the format of output params. One of PEM or DER.
- void * output_data
- will contain a certificate request PEM or DER encoded
- size_t * output_data_size
- holds the size of output_data (and will be replaced by the actual size of parameters)
Description
This function will export the certificate request to a PEM or DER encoded PKCS10 structure.If the buffer provided is not long enough to hold the output, then GNUTLS_E_SHORT_MEMORY_BUFFER will be returned and * output_data_size will be updated.
If the structure is PEM encoded, it will have a header of "BEGIN NEW CERTIFICATE REQUEST".
Returns
On success, GNUTLS_E_SUCCESS (0) is returned, otherwise a negative error value.Reporting Bugs
